Olof Johansson has just posted a way to install an alternative Linux distro on the new Chromebook: https://plus.google.com/u/0/109993695638569781190/posts/b2fazijJppZ He has succeded with Suse just using the Suse root filesystem and the Chrome OS stock kernel. It looks like a complicated procedure (at least for me) and the catch is that it will boot from the Chrome partition, but I understand that he and other developers are working on booting from an external storage altogether.
